About this event

    This is an NRA Certified eight (8) hour course designed to develop the basic knowledge, skills and attitude necessary for the identification and safe handling and storage of firearms. Course topics include: gun safety rules, ammunition knowledge and selection, firearm selection and storage, shooting fundamentals, firearm inspection and maintenance, marksmanship, two-handed shooting positions, and shooting range safety.

    Students will complete live fire training as well as a nationally standardized shooting qualification while on the range with an NRA Certified Instructor. Students will receive a course completion certificate.

    Participants must bring a properly functioning handgun, 150 rounds of ammunition, and eye & ear protection. Firearm rental and ammunition are available for an additional fee.
